Songaon is a Rural village located in Gandhwani, Dhar, Madhya-pradesh.

The total population of Songaon is 1,548.

Songaon village comprises 331 households.

The literacy rate in Songaon is 65.3%. Among the literate population of 871, there are 529 literate males and 342 literate females.

In Songaon, there are 777 males and 771 females, with a sex ratio of 992 females per 1000 males.

There are 215 children (13.9% of population), comprising 108 boys and 107 girls.

The total number of workers in Songaon is 808, with 640 main workers and 168 marginal workers.

In Songaon, there are 77 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(40 males, 37 females) and 1,144 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(572 males, 572 females).

Songaon is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Dhar district, and falls under Gandhwani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 475307 and LGD code is 475307.
